rdfs:comment | - Erich Wilhelm August Vielwerth (10 February 1912 – 12 August 1997) was a highly decorated Oberleutnant in the Wehrmacht during World War II who was awarded the Knight's Cross of the Iron Cross. The Knight's Cross of the Iron Cross was awarded to recognise extreme battlefield bravery or successful military leadership. Erich Vielwerth was captured by American troops in May 1945, and was released in August 1945.
